.EmbroideryOptions__option .color label{display:block;width:25px;height:25px;border-radius:100%;box-shadow:0 0 0 1px #eaeaea;border:3px solid #eaeaea;cursor:pointer;background-position:center!important;background-size:cover!important;padding:unset}.EmbroideryOptions__option .color label[for=name-color-black],.EmbroideryOptions__option .color label[for=icon-color-black],.EmbroideryOptions__option .color label[for=name-color-black_both],.EmbroideryOptions__option .color label[for=icon-color-black_both]{background-color:#000}.EmbroideryOptions__option .color label[for=name-color-white],.EmbroideryOptions__option .color label[for=icon-color-white],.EmbroideryOptions__option .color label[for=name-color-white_both],.EmbroideryOptions__option .color label[for=icon-color-white_both]{background-color:#fff}.enb-option{margin-bottom:24px!important}.enb-image__wrapper{position:relative}.emb-text{position:absolute;display:flex;flex-direction:column;text-align:center}.emb-text span{color:transparent;font-size:20px;line-height:24px}.emb-text.right{top:37%!important;left:-94px;opacity:1}@media(max-width:768px){.emb-text.right{top:39%!important;left:-120px}}@media(max-width:425px){.emb-text.right{top:35%!important;left:-80px}}.emb-text.left{top:17%;right:30%;opacity:1}.emb-text.center{top:25%;left:50%;transform:translate(-50%,-50%)}.enb-image.style-3 .emb-text{position:absolute;top:42%;right:22px;opacity:1}@media(max-width:768px){.enb-image.style-3 .emb-text{top:44%;right:51px}.emb-text span{font-size:24px!important}}@media(max-width:425px){.enb-image.style-3 .emb-text{top:41%;right:30px}.emb-text span{font-size:15px!important}}.emb-text.black span{color:#000}.emb-text.white span{color:#fff}.emb-text.script span,#font-script+label{font-family:Rochester!important}body.product .section.recent-view{display:none!important}.product__description-long{display:none}a{color:#363636}.main-page-title{margin-bottom:24px!important}.faq-section .grid__item a{text-decoration:none}.trash-icon{display:flex;align-items:center;padding-left:10px}.trash-icon img{padding-right:16px;border-right:1px solid #000}span.edit-text{padding-left:16px!important;font-size:14px!important;font-weight:500!important;line-height:18px!important}.trash-icon{display:none}.trash-icon.show{display:flex}.enb-image.style-1 .emb-text.right{top:7%;left:30%}.enb-image.style-1 .emb-text.left{top:7%;right:34%}.enb-image.style-1 .emb-text span{font-size:15px;line-height:19px}.popup-content{max-height:80vh;overflow:auto}body.scroll-disable{overflow:hidden}.eng-block{display:flex;padding:10px 13px;align-items:center;justify-content:space-between;flex-wrap:wrap;gap:10px;border:1px solid #D2D1D1;border-radius:10px}.eng-icon{display:flex;align-items:center;column-gap:19px}.eng-icon span,.eng-price span{font-size:16px;font-weight:500!important;line-height:20px}.eng-price{display:flex;align-items:center;column-gap:10px}.eng-wrapper{margin-top:40px;margin-bottom:00px}a.eng-view{font-size:14px;font-weight:450;line-height:18px;color:#848484}.eng-line{display:flex;justify-content:space-between;width:100%}.eng_price_free{display:grid;grid-auto-flow:row;align-items:center;justify-items:end}@media only screen and (max-width:375px){.eng-block{flex-direction:column;align-items:flex-start}.eng-line{flex-direction:column;align-items:flex-start;gap:10px}.eng_price_free{justify-items:start}}.popup{display:none;position:fixed;z-index:11111;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#00000080}.popup-content{background-color:#fefefe;margin:auto;padding:0;border:1px solid #888;width:100%;max-width:850px;position:relative;top:50%;transform:translateY(-50%)}.close{color:#363636;float:right;font-size:28px;position:absolute;top:14px;right:14px;z-index:1}.enb-content{padding:30px 40px}.close:hover,.close:focus{color:#363636;text-decoration:none;cursor:pointer}.eng-block{cursor:pointer}.enb-image img{width:100%;height:auto}.popup-wrapper{display:grid;grid-template-columns:1fr 1fr;column-gap:20px}.opt-box input[type=radio]{display:none}.opt-box label{border:1px solid #EDEDED;font-size:13px!important;height:28px;outline:none;display:flex;justify-content:center;align-items:center;cursor:pointer;border-radius:5px;background-color:#ededed;padding:5px 15px;letter-spacing:0!important;text-transform:capitalize!important}.opt-box input[type=radio]:checked+label{border-color:#000}.opt-box{display:flex;gap:10px}.enb-name-input .text{gap:5px;display:flex;flex-wrap:wrap}#env-popup .hide{display:none!important}.EmbroideryOptions__textWrap{width:100%}.EmbroideryOptions__textCount{border-style:solid;border-width:1px;padding:11px 16px;display:flex;align-items:center;border-color:#d2d1d1;border-radius:6px}.enb-name-input .text input[type=text]{width:100%;border:none;padding:0 20px 0 0}.enb-name-input .text input[type=text]::placeholder{color:#ccc}.EmbroideryOptions__textCount span{color:#ccc;font-size:13px}.enb-name-input .text input[type=text]:focus-visible{outline:none;box-shadow:none}.enb-name-input__title,.enb-name-option p{font-size:15px;font-weight:450;line-height:19px;display:block;margin-bottom:11px}.enb-name-option{margin-bottom:20px}h3.enb-heading{font-size:23px;font-weight:500;line-height:29px;margin-bottom:25px}.fs-16{font-size:16px}.flex{display:flex}.space-between{justify-content:space-between}.gap-20{gap:20px}.enb-detail span{font-weight:500!important}.enb-name-input{margin-bottom:20px}.EmbroideryOptions__terms{margin-top:14px}.EmbroideryOptions__terms fieldset{padding:0;border:none;display:flex;align-items:center;column-gap:10px}.EmbroideryOptions__terms a{color:#363636}.EmbroideryOptions__terms label{font-size:11px;font-weight:450;line-height:14px;letter-spacing:0!important;text-transform:unset!important;margin-bottom:0}.EmbroideryOptions__terms input[type=checkbox]{margin:0;width:16px;height:16px;border:1px solid #d2d1d1}.enb-image{display:flex;align-items:center}.hide_input{display:none}.EmbroideryOptions__action button{padding:9px;width:calc(50% - 3.5px);border-radius:100px;font-size:15px;font-weight:500!important;max-height:38px;min-height:unset}.EmbroideryOptions__action button:before,.EmbroideryOptions__action button:after{border-radius:100px}.EmbroideryOptions__action{display:flex;justify-content:space-between;margin-top:35px}.EmbroideryOptions__Error{color:red;font-size:12px}.pf__embroidery-preview fieldset{border:none;padding:0}.pf__embroidery-preview label{font-size:12px;font-weight:500!important;display:inline-block;letter-spacing:0!important}.pf__embroidery-preview input[type=text]{font-size:12px;padding:0;margin:0;border:none}.pf__embroidery-preview{display:none}.pf__embroidery-preview.show{display:block}.cart-item.enbFlag{display:none!important}.template-search form.search .field__label{left:40px}.enb-name-option.enb-option.invisible,.enb-color-input.invisible,.second-line-invisible{display:none}ul.ITG_flag_container.disabled{opacity:.5;pointer-events:none}.emb-text.knife{opacity:1;top:45%!important;left:0%!important;color:#000;transform:rotate(41deg);width:100%;margin-left:auto;margin-right:auto;font-size:.8em}@media(max-width:768px){.emb-text.knife{top:63%!important;left:21%!important}}@media(max-width:425px){.emb-text.knife{top:57%!important;left:13%!important;font-size:.8em}}.emb-text.knife span{color:#000;font-size:1em!important;line-height:normal;width:fit-content;margin:auto 90px}span.flag-additional-price{padding-left:10px}.para{font-size:12px;padding-left:30px;color:gray}img.knife-img-itg{transform:rotate(90deg)}.EmbroideryOptions__option .color label[for=name-color-gold],.EmbroideryOptions__option .color label[for=icon-color-gold],.EmbroideryOptions__option .color label[for=name-color-gold_both],.EmbroideryOptions__option .color label[for=icon-color-gold_both]{background-color:gold}.EmbroideryOptions__option .color label[for=name-color-red],.EmbroideryOptions__option .color label[for=icon-color-red],.EmbroideryOptions__option .color label[for=name-color-red_both],.EmbroideryOptions__option .color label[for=icon-color-red_both]{background-color:red}.EmbroideryOptions__option .color label[for=name-color-green],.EmbroideryOptions__option .color label[for=icon-color-green],.EmbroideryOptions__option .color label[for=name-color-green_both],.EmbroideryOptions__option .color label[for=icon-color-green_both]{background-color:#0d9655}.EmbroideryOptions__option .color label[for=name-color-silver],.EmbroideryOptions__option .color label[for=icon-color-silver],.EmbroideryOptions__option .color label[for=name-color-silver_both],.EmbroideryOptions__option .color label[for=icon-color-silver_both]{background-color:silver}.EmbroideryOptions__option .color label[for=name-color-pink],.EmbroideryOptions__option .color label[for=icon-color-pink],.EmbroideryOptions__option .color label[for=name-color-pink_both],.EmbroideryOptions__option .color label[for=icon-color-pink_both]{background-color:pink}.EmbroideryOptions__option .color label[for=name-color-bordeaux],.EmbroideryOptions__option .color label[for=icon-color-bordeaux],.EmbroideryOptions__option .color label[for=name-color-bordeaux_both],.EmbroideryOptions__option .color label[for=icon-color-bordeaux_both]{background-color:#5a002c}.EmbroideryOptions__option .color label[for=name-color-beige],.EmbroideryOptions__option .color label[for=icon-color-beige],.EmbroideryOptions__option .color label[for=name-color-beige_both],.EmbroideryOptions__option .color label[for=icon-color-beige_both]{background-color:beige}.EmbroideryOptions__option .color label[for=name-color-dark-blue],.EmbroideryOptions__option .color label[for=icon-color-dark-blue],.EmbroideryOptions__option .color label[for=name-color-dark-blue_both],.EmbroideryOptions__option .color label[for=icon-color-dark-blue_both]{background-color:#00008b}.EmbroideryOptions__option .color label[for=name-color-orange],.EmbroideryOptions__option .color label[for=icon-color-orange],.EmbroideryOptions__option .color label[for=name-color-orange_both],.EmbroideryOptions__option .color label[for=icon-color-orange_both]{background-color:#ffc000}.EmbroideryOptions__option .color label[for=name-color-dark-grey],.EmbroideryOptions__option .color label[for=icon-color-dark-grey],.EmbroideryOptions__option .color label[for=name-color-dark-grey_both],.EmbroideryOptions__option .color label[for=icon-color-dark-grey_both]{background-color:#a9a9a9}.EmbroideryOptions__option .color label[for=name-color-royal-blue],.EmbroideryOptions__option .color label[for=icon-color-royal-blue],.EmbroideryOptions__option .color label[for=name-color-royal-blue_both],.EmbroideryOptions__option .color label[for=icon-color-royal-blue_both]{background-color:#4169e1}.opt-box{flex-wrap:wrap}.enb-content.style-3 #name-right+label{display:flex}.Cart_7800094228660{display:none!important}.emb-text.gold span{color:gold}.emb-text.red span{color:red}.emb-text.silver span{color:silver}.emb-text.pink span{color:pink}.emb-text.bordeaux span{color:#5a002c}.emb-text.beige span{color:beige}.emb-text.dark-blue span{color:#00008b}.emb-text.dark-grey span{color:#a9a9a9}.emb-text.orange span{color:#ffc000}.emb-text.royal-blue span{color:#4169e1}.emb-text.green span{color:#0d9655}.button.product-form__cart-reset{border:1px solid #0d1c46}.button.product-form__cart-submit{background-color:#0d1c46;color:#fff}.trash-icon.show{display:flex!important}.product_desc{display:none}.cst_addtocart{display:flex;justify-content:center;letter-spacing:0;font-size:17px}.product-block+.product-block--price{margin-bottom:5px}.product__price.on-sale{color:#d69000}.product__price.product__price--compare{font-size:.9em}.product__price-savings{justify-content:left}.add-cart-price .product__price{color:#fff}.add-cart-price{display:inline-flex;align-items:center;font-size:18px;line-height:23px}.add-cart-price .product-block{margin-bottom:0}.add-cart-price .product__price-savings,.add-cart-price .product__price--compare{display:none}.collection-color-option-white,.color-swatch--white{background:#fbf2f2!important}.collection-color-option-black,.color-swatch--black{background:#000!important}.collection-color-option-red,.color-swatch--red{background:red!important}.collection-color-option-beige,.color-swatch--beige{background:#ffd9bd!important}.collection-color-option-green,.color-swatch--green{background:#0d9655!important}.collection-color-option-raspberry,.color-swatch--raspberry{background:#e30b5d!important}.collection-color-option-brown,.color-swatch--brown{background:#803136!important}.collection-color-option-bordeaux,.color-swatch--bordeaux{background:#6d071a!important}.collection-color-option-orange,.color-swatch--orange{background:#ff740f!important}.collection-color-option-pink,.color-swatch--pink{background:#f478b3!important}.collection-color-option-purple,.color-swatch--purple{background:#950fff!important}.collection-color-option-navy-blue,.color-swatch--navy-blue{background:#1f1f52!important}.collection-color-option-khaki,.color-swatch--khaki{background:#4e655a!important}.collection-color-option-gray,.color-swatch--gray{background:#878787!important}.collection-color-option-blue,.color-swatch--blue{background:#21aeeb!important}.collection-color-option-fuschia,.color-swatch--fuschia{background:#f0f!important}.collection-color-option-pistachio,.color-swatch--pistachio{background:#cbd679!important}.collection-color-option-sky-blue,.color-swatch--sky-blue{background:#87ceeb!important}.collection-color-option-turquoise,.color-swatch--turquoise{background:#40e0d0!important}.collection-color-option-lime,.color-swatch--lime{background:#dad05c!important}.collection-color-option-yellow,.color-swatch--yellow{background:#d59e4a!important}.collection-color-option-black-denim,.color-swatch--black-denim{background:#393a3e!important}.collection-color-option-blue-denim,.color-swatch--blue-denim{background:#4b597d!important}.mobile-list{display:none!important}.rest-num{height:24px;width:24px;border:1px solid #000;border-radius:100%;font-size:13px;display:flex;align-items:center;justify-content:center}.collection-color-option-white-navyblue{background:linear-gradient(135deg,#fff 0% 50%,#1f1f52 50% 100%)!important}.collection-color-list{display:flex;gap:8px;width:fit-content;margin:0 auto;flex-wrap:wrap;align-items:center;justify-content:center;padding:5px 0}.collection-color-option{border-radius:100%;box-shadow:0 0 0 1px #d9d9d9;border:3px solid #fff;cursor:pointer;background-position:center!important;background-size:cover!important;width:22px;height:22px;border-width:2px;margin:1px;display:block!important}.collection-color-option:hover{box-shadow:0 0 0 1px #000!important}.pair_coll .grid-product__image-mask{width:50%}.pair_coll .grid__item-image-wrapper{display:flex;gap:15px}.drawer .cart__remove{display:block!important}.cart__item.enbFlag{display:none}.embroidery_addtocart{letter-spacing:0;text-transform:uppercase;font-size:17px}.eng_freetext{display:none;color:#25b525;font-size:20px;font-weight:600}.opt-box label.invisible{display:none}.product-block--tab .collapsible-content--all p>strong{margin-right:5px}.emb-text.hobo span,#font-script+label{font-family:Hobo}.emb-text.inscription span,#font-script+label{font-family:Inscription}.emb-text.victoria span,#font-script+label{font-family:Victoria}.emb-text.brush_script span,#font-script+label{font-family:Brush Script}.emb-text.frequency span,#font-script+label{font-family:Frequency}.emb-text.russtime span,#font-script+label{font-family:Russtime}.emb-text.diana_script span,#font-script+label{font-family:Diana Script}@media only screen and (max-width:769px){.opt-box label{font-size:11px!important;padding:5px 10px!important}}@media screen and (max-width:768px){.product-block--header-mobile-top{margin-bottom:20px;order:-1}.template-product .grid-manelli{margin:0 15px}}@media screen and (max-width:768px){.grid{display:flex;flex-direction:column}.content-column{display:flex;flex-direction:column;order:1}.mobile-header-top{order:-1;margin-bottom:15px}.image-column{order:0;margin-bottom:20px}.product-single__meta{order:1;text-align:left}.product-description-container{display:none}.popup-wrapper{grid-template-columns:1fr}.enb-content{padding:30px 20px}.popup-content{max-width:95%}}.product-single__meta{padding-left:0!important;padding-right:45px}@media screen and (max-width:768px){.product-single__meta{padding-right:0;text-align:left}.product-single__title{font-size:1.4em;margin:5px 0!important}.product-single__sku{font-size:.9em}}.product-grid-container{display:grid;gap:20px;grid-template-columns:100%;grid-template-areas:"header" "image" "meta";justify-items:stretch;align-items:stretch}.header-area{grid-area:header;width:100%}.image-area{grid-area:image;width:100%}.meta-area{grid-area:meta;width:100%}@media screen and (min-width:769px){.product-grid-container{grid-template-columns:40% 60%;grid-template-areas:"image header" "image meta";column-gap:40px;row-gap:0}.image-area{height:100%}.image-area.product-single__sticky{position:sticky;top:20px}}.image-area img,.image-area .product-images-wrapper{width:100%!important;height:auto!important;display:block}.header-area .product-block--header,.meta-area .product-single__meta{width:100%!important;max-width:none!important}.product-main-slide .image-wrap{position:relative}.product-main-slide .dots{position:absolute;display:flex;flex-direction:column;top:10px;right:10px;gap:6px;z-index:3}.product-main-slide .dots .dot{display:inline-flex;align-items:center;justify-content:center;padding:6px 8px;background:#d80122;color:#fff;font-weight:700;line-height:1;border-radius:4px;font-size:.95em;white-space:nowrap}.product-main-slide .dots .dot.exclu-web{background:#fdc425;color:#fff;text-transform:uppercase;font-weight:700}@media screen and (min-width:769px){.product-main-slide .dots{flex-direction:row}.product-main-slide .dots.sales{flex-direction:column}}.product-main-slide .embroidery-offer{position:absolute;bottom:10px;right:10px;width:20%;min-width:84px;z-index:2}.product-main-slide .embroidery-offer img{width:100%;height:auto;display:block}.product-main-slide .engraving-offer{display:flex;align-items:center;justify-content:center;text-align:center;position:absolute;bottom:10px;right:10px;width:100px;height:100px;background:#fdc425;color:#000;border-radius:100%;font-weight:700;text-transform:uppercase;padding-top:15px;z-index:2}.product-main-slide .engraving-offer span,.product-main-slide .engraving-offer .fa-knife-kitchen{color:#fff}.product-main-slide .engraving-offer .fa-knife-kitchen{font-size:1.7em}@media screen and (max-width:768px){.product-main-slide .embroidery-offer{width:24%;min-width:72px}.product-main-slide .engraving-offer{width:86px;height:86px;font-size:.85em}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/product-page.css.map */
